Requirements and Costs for Applying for Personalized Number Plates in Kenya

Personalized number plates have become one of the most exclusive vehicle registration options available under the National Transport and Safety Authority.

It allows motor vehicle owners to move beyond standard identification and adopt customized combinations that reflect identity, branding, or personal meaning.

At the top end, customized plates can cost as much as Ksh 1 million, making them a luxury feature mainly associated with prestige and exclusivity on Kenyan roads.

Unlike standard registration plates, personalized number plates allow vehicle owners to select unique alphanumeric combinations or names, subject to availability and approval.

NTSA Personalized Number Plates in Kenya:  Costs, Meaning, and How to Apply

A number of  Kenyans opt for these plates for different reasons, with some using them as status symbols, while others choose meaningful combinations, such as birth dates, initials, business names, or special codes that carry personal significance.

Others view them as a branding tool, especially for business owners who want their vehicles to stand out.

ADVERTISEMENT

It’s worth noting that the names of political parties, derogatory names, and names that provoke ethnic or racial tensions are not allowed.

According to NTSA, the number plate is not transferable to another party.

Among the people with personalized number plates are former Nairobi Governor Mike Sonko, flamboyant lawyer Donald Kipkorir, international football stars MacDonald Mariga and his brother Victor Wanyama.

Types of Number Plates

The NTSA offers three main categories of number plates, with the first being the standard number plates. It costs approximately Ksh 3,050 and is issued the all registered vehicles.

The special number plate, priced at about Ksh 30,000, allows motorists to select preferred combinations, including meaningful numbers or simple personalized sequences.

It is guided by an individual who prefers a certain set of letters or numbers. For instance, if you have three cars and want all the plates to end with 024R.

The most exclusive category is the customized number plate, which costs Ksh 1 million. This option gives applicants the freedom to choose unique names, words, or highly specific combinations, subject to approval and availability.

How to Apply for Personalized Number Plates via eCitizen

The process applies to registered owners of motor vehicles with civilian registration numbers who wish to be issued personalized number plates.

The vehicle must have been registered with civilian numbers. The process does not apply to Public Service Vehicles (PSV) and Commercial Motor Vehicles.

Applications for personalized number plates are made through the eCitizen Portal.

The process starts by logging in to the portal and selecting the vehicle to be registered. Applicants then proceed to the “Motor Vehicle Services” section and choose the “Reflective Plate” option.

They are required to select the type of plate—normal, special, or customized—and to indicate the reason for the application, such as new-generation plates. Applicants also choose their preferred notification method.

If the number you are applying for is already taken, the system will show it as unavailable. You will decide to wait for the following series of number plates,

Supporting documents must then be uploaded, including a scanned copy of the logbook and a PDF image of the current number plates. Applicants are also required to select a collection centre and provide the ID number of the person authorized to collect the plates.

Once an applicant confirms all details and accepts the declaration, they then proceed to payment and submit the application.

Approval, Processing, and Collection

Once the application is submitted, applicants receive confirmation messages via SMS. Further updates are sent once the application is approved and when the plates are ready for collection.

The processing period is typically around five working days, depending on verification and production timelines.

When collecting the plates, motorists must present their original national ID and any old plates they are replacing.
